diff options
author | Hiroyuki Ikezoe <poincare@ikezoe.net> | 2006-06-14 03:27:28 +0800 |
---|---|---|
committer | Andre Klapper <aklapper@src.gnome.org> | 2006-06-14 03:27:28 +0800 |
commit | 14794b3d26e6be55aba0dd173dbb81c288b13ba5 (patch) | |
tree | 25922f5fe2e63dde419eea81bd04707112556da9 /addressbook | |
parent | 8d9d2df3483b44a5e3e5f1fb382401adecb82b23 (diff) | |
download | gsoc2013-evolution-14794b3d26e6be55aba0dd173dbb81c288b13ba5.tar.gz gsoc2013-evolution-14794b3d26e6be55aba0dd173dbb81c288b13ba5.tar.zst gsoc2013-evolution-14794b3d26e6be55aba0dd173dbb81c288b13ba5.zip |
** Fixes bug #342646 Plugged memory leak. Ditto.
2006-06-13 Hiroyuki Ikezoe <poincare@ikezoe.net>
** Fixes bug #342646
* gui/widgets/e-addressbook-view.c: Plugged memory leak.
* gui/widgets/e-minicard-view.c: Ditto.
svn path=/trunk/; revision=32129
Diffstat (limited to 'addressbook')
-rw-r--r-- | addressbook/ChangeLog | 6 | ||||
-rw-r--r-- | addressbook/gui/widgets/e-addressbook-view.c | 4 | ||||
-rw-r--r-- | addressbook/gui/widgets/e-minicard-view.c | 2 |
3 files changed, 11 insertions, 1 deletions
diff --git a/addressbook/ChangeLog b/addressbook/ChangeLog index fdad04e0a4..e1e1498e8e 100644 --- a/addressbook/ChangeLog +++ b/addressbook/ChangeLog @@ -1,3 +1,9 @@ +2006-06-13 Hiroyuki Ikezoe <poincare@ikezoe.net> + + ** Fixes bug #342646 + * gui/widgets/e-addressbook-view.c: Plugged memory leak. + * gui/widgets/e-minicard-view.c: Ditto. + 2006-06-13 Oswald Rodrigues <ozzy_rodrigues@yahoo.com> * gui/contact-editor/e-contact-quick-add.c (build_quick_add_dialog): diff --git a/addressbook/gui/widgets/e-addressbook-view.c b/addressbook/gui/widgets/e-addressbook-view.c index 2a6b462337..bf541bb05c 100644 --- a/addressbook/gui/widgets/e-addressbook-view.c +++ b/addressbook/gui/widgets/e-addressbook-view.c @@ -1150,6 +1150,7 @@ table_drag_data_get (ETable *table, selection_data->target, 8, value, strlen (value)); + g_free (value); break; } case DND_TARGET_TYPE_SOURCE_VCARD: { @@ -1161,6 +1162,7 @@ table_drag_data_get (ETable *table, selection_data->target, 8, value, strlen (value)); + g_free (value); break; } } @@ -1973,7 +1975,7 @@ selection_get (GtkWidget *invisible, gtk_selection_data_set (selection_data, GDK_SELECTION_TYPE_STRING, 8, value, strlen (value)); - + g_free (value); } static void diff --git a/addressbook/gui/widgets/e-minicard-view.c b/addressbook/gui/widgets/e-minicard-view.c index eeb1daea11..34085b4a4a 100644 --- a/addressbook/gui/widgets/e-minicard-view.c +++ b/addressbook/gui/widgets/e-minicard-view.c @@ -95,6 +95,7 @@ e_minicard_view_drag_data_get(GtkWidget *widget, selection_data->target, 8, value, strlen (value)); + g_free (value); break; } case DND_TARGET_TYPE_SOURCE_VCARD_LIST: { @@ -108,6 +109,7 @@ e_minicard_view_drag_data_get(GtkWidget *widget, selection_data->target, 8, value, strlen (value)); + g_free (value); break; } } |